Maharashtra Chief Minister Prithviraj Chavan said his government would rope in international consultants to develop infrastructure on priority basis at Rajiv Gandhi Infotech Park at Hinjewadi near here.
I will soon convene a meeting at Mantralaya to discuss speedy implementation of infrastructure development proposals in the area which will include road network,power,water,and CCTV control room for security. We will engage international consultants for this work, he said.
Chavan,who visited the IT hub,held a meeting with representatives of various IT companies situated in the campus and assured them speedy resolution of the problems being faced by them.
He was accompanied by state Industries Minister Narayan Rane.
